Hirdetés
- sziku69: Fűzzük össze a szavakat :)
 - Luck Dragon: Asszociációs játék. :)
 - sh4d0w: Kalózkodás. Kalózkodás?
 - D1Rect: Nagy "hülyétkapokazapróktól" topik
 - gban: Ingyen kellene, de tegnapra
 - Sub-ZeRo: Euro Truck Simulator 2 & American Truck Simulator 1 (esetleg 2 majd, ha lesz) :)
 - sziku69: Szólánc.
 - Brogyi: CTEK akkumulátor töltő és másolatai
 - Mr Dini: Mindent a StreamSharkról!
 - btz: Internet fejlesztés országosan!
 
Új hozzászólás Aktív témák
- 
			
			
						martonx
veterán
válasz
							
							
								Jester01
							
							
								#1270
							
							üzenetére
						"Azt kétlem, hogy egyetlen BIT mező tárolásához ne foglalna le legalább egy byteot. Esetleg ha több ilyen mező van egy rekordban akkor összepakolhatja őket." - ez igaz, ez annyival árnyalja a képet, hogy a helymegtakarítás nem feltétlenül jön elő.
Viszont kettő plusz szempontot még mondok a bit mellett. 1. amikor lehetséges méretcsökkenésről beszélünk ott ne csak a tábla által elfoglalt helyet vegyük figyelembe, hanem könnyebben, több mindent tarthat a memória pufferében az SQL motor, illetve az adatok átadásakor is megjelenik a kisebb méretből fakadó előny. Nem mindegy, hogy egy SQL lekérésre 100.000 byte-ot, vagy 100.000 bit-et kapunk vissza.
 - 
			
			
						sonar
addikt
válasz
							
							
								Jester01
							
							
								#705
							
							üzenetére
						Nem!
SELECT * FROM tdc_lc_lot_info where order_no like 'TDC%' and Create_Time < date_sub(curdate(),interval 10 DAY);Hibaüzi: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'SELECT * FROM tdc_lc_lot_info where order_no like 'TDC%' and Create_Time < date_' at line 2Viszont a második kódsorod lefut szépen.

 - 
			
			
						sonar
addikt
válasz
							
							
								Jester01
							
							
								#596
							
							üzenetére
						Nah megtaláltam a megoldást
my.ini -ben (win alatt, linuxnál my.cnf)
[mysqld]
log=query.log
illetve ezt a parancsot kell még kiadni: SET GLOBAL general_log = 'ON';és már minden query loggolva van.

Loggolás likapcsolása
SET GLOBAL general_log = 'OFF';Még vmi.
Ha update paracsot adom ki akkor kell léteznie a rekordnak? Akkor is lefut ha nem létezik?
Csak azért kérdem mert most per pill 2 napig nem leszek olyan gép közelbe, hogy ki tudjam próbálni. - 
			
			
						anjani182
őstag
válasz
							
							
								Jester01
							
							
								#588
							
							üzenetére
						Attacholtam! Most az xy számlázó program sql serverében van 2 adatbázis, ha átnevezem a beattacholtat, akkor sem indul a program, ezért gondoltam, hogy át kellene importálni a mentést az üres adatbázisba!
 
Vagy hogy tudom megadni, hogy az uj beattacholt adatbázisból dolgozzon az mssql server?! Nem értek hozzá, ezért lehet hogy már működnie kellene, csak valamit nem jól csinálok

MOD: közben a kiexportált fájlbol akartam importálni, ugyanugy ugyanaz a hiba!

 - 
			
			
 - 
			
			
						VladimirR
nagyúr
válasz
							
							
								Jester01
							
							
								#314
							
							üzenetére
						kosz a valaszt (RedAnt, neked is)
varchar -nak a rekordban van foglalva hely (a maximális hossznak)
amennyire tudom, a varcharnak pont ez a lenyege a char-ral szemben, hogy nincs szamara a maximalis hossz lefoglalva, csak a hossz + 1 byte (ujabban (mysql5-tol talan), ha a varchar hossza nagyobb, mint 255 karakter, akkor lehet hossz + 2 byte is)
alter table tablanev add index ( mezo1 ).|. table tablanev add index ( mezo2 );
most latom csak, a ph motor kiszurte a lekerdezest, az ott eredetileg nem egy ''pocs'' volt, hanem egy masik alter (amennyire eszrevettem, ha a kovetkezo karaktersor van, akkor az atalakul .|. karakterekke: ; sqlparancs
ha van ket tablam van-e kulonbseg sebessegben, memoriahasznalatban az alabbi ketto kozott:
miert biztosabb es mit ertesz ezalatt?
(egyebkent most latom csak, hogy ezt meg en irtam el: a masodiknak ez a vege: tabla1.name = 'nev' - 
			
			
						RedAnt
aktív tag
válasz
							
							
								Jester01
							
							
								#314
							
							üzenetére
						ha van ket tablam van-e kulonbseg sebessegben, memoriahasznalatban az alabbi ketto kozott:
Ránézésre nincs (feltéve, hogy van index mind a 2 lekérdezéshez). De az első a biztosabb.
még annyit tennék hozzá hogy az első esetnél, ha egy konkrét sorra keresel a név alapján, akkor distinct-el érdemes és limit 1-gyel, így az első találatnál leáll, és használja az indexeket teljes tábla-scan helyett akkor is ha alapból figyelmen kívül hagyná. Forrás: [link] 
Új hozzászólás Aktív témák
- Valami baja van a tápomnak
 - Minőségi ugrást hozhat a One új médiaboxa?
 - exHWSW - Értünk mindenhez IS
 - iPhone topik
 - Mindenki bukja a Blackwell chipeket, ha bejön Trump terve
 - Rendkívül ütőképesnek tűnik az újragondolt Apple tv
 - Renault, Dacia topik
 - Intel Core i3 / i5 / i7 8xxx "Coffee Lake" és i5 / i7 / i9 9xxx “Coffee Lake Refresh” (LGA1151)
 - Vezeték nélküli fejhallgatók
 - Kamionok, fuvarozás, logisztika topik
 - További aktív témák...
 
- Gainward Phoenix 3080 10G golden sample
 - Gamer PC RTX 3060TI I7-9700k 16GB RAM 1 TB SSD
 - ASUS ROG RTX 3060 OC 12GB GDDR6
 - Eladó vadonatúj Huawei FreeBuds Pro 4 fülhallgatók! (Bontatlan 24 hónap garancia)
 - HIHETETLEN! DE ÚJ DOBOZOS LAPTOPOK AKÁR FÉLPÉNZÉRT FÉLÁRON !!! ///////// FÉLPÉNZES LAPTOP //////////
 
- GYÖNYÖRŰ iPhone 12 Pro 256GB Gold -1 ÉV GARANCIA - Kártyafüggetlen, MS3438, 94% Akkumulátor
 - Azonnali készpénzes nVidia RTX 4000 sorozat videokártya felvásárlás személyesen / csomagküldéssel
 - 2 TB-os Kingston NV3 M.2 SSD - 6000 MB/s olvasás
 - HIBÁTLAN iPhone 13 Pro 128GB Graphite -1 ÉV GARANCIA - Kártyafüggetlen, MS3747, 91% Akkumulátor
 - ÁRGARANCIA!Épített KomPhone Ryzen 5 7500F 32/64GB RAM RX 9060 XT 16GB GAMER PC termékbeszámítással
 
Állásajánlatok
Cég: Promenade Publishing House Kft.
Város: Budapest
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est
								
							
								
								

								
 
								
								
								
 
								
								
								
								
								
								
								
 


